Nothing New is Added
Aside from the remastered visuals, and trophy support, the Chronicles HD Collection offers nothing new from its predeccesor. The same exact version was simply ported, offering nothing new to entice gamers into picking the game up again for those who have played it on the Wii.

VERDICT

Resident Evil Chronicles HD Collection is a great game for anyone who wants to refresh their memory in regards to the backstory of the game. For those who have played the game before on the Nintendo Wii, you will most likely have no reason to pick the game up as it offers nothing new from its predecessor aside from its revamped visuals and trophy support. However, gamers who never had a Wii and didn’t get a chance to play the Umbrella and Darkside Chronicles, picking this one up is highly recommended.
